What D Personalities ACTUALLY Want

This episode of The Slow Pitch talks about the D Personality, sales strategy, and how to sell to a D Personality. This episode covers the D Personality of DiSC and how to speak to, listen to, maintain control of a sales meeting. Sometimes a D Personality can come across as rough and gruff, but once you realize why they're that way, you start to understand how to sell to them. D Personalities can be tough on your ego, but they don't have to be. Once you understand why they behave that way, you can start to use that energy to guide them toward the sale.
